在犬类模型中,1,6-二磷酸果糖未能限制早期心肌梗死面积。

Fructose-1,6-diphosphate fails to limit early myocardial infarction size in a canine model.

作者信息

Angelos M G, Leasure J E, Barton R L

机构信息

Department of Emergency Medicine, Wright State University, Cox Institute, Kettering, Ohio.

出版信息

Ann Emerg Med. 1993 Feb;22(2):171-7. doi: 10.1016/s0196-0644(05)80197-0.

DOI:10.1016/s0196-0644(05)80197-0
PMID:8427426
Abstract

STUDY OBJECTIVE

Fructose-1,6-diphosphate (FDP) appears to improve early post-myocardial infarction hemodynamics and limit early myocardial infarct size in previous canine studies. However, these studies did not account for the effect of collateral blood flow on infarct size. Our objective was to determine the effect of FDP on early infarct size and hemodynamics while measuring regional myocardial blood flow.

DESIGN

A prospective, blinded, placebo-controlled laboratory study using a canine open-chest left anterior descending coronary artery (LAD) occlusion model.

INTERVENTIONS

Twenty-two mongrel dogs were assigned randomly to receive either FDP (175 mg/kg, then 2 mg/kg/min for two hours) or placebo, beginning five minutes after LAD occlusion.

MEASUREMENTS AND MAIN RESULTS

Regional myocardial blood flow, hemodynamics, and myocardial infarct size were determined. Infarct size was assessed using magnetic resonance imaging in a subset of animals. Three of the 22 dogs had no infarct and significantly higher collateral blood flow than the 19 animals with myocardial infarction (P < .001). Four hours after LAD occlusion, cardiac index, dP/dtmax, heart rate, and systolic and mean aortic pressures were not statistically different between groups. Infarct size expressed as area of necrosis/area at risk was similar between groups (FDP, 0.55 +/- 0.28; controls, 0.59 +/- 0.31).

CONCLUSION

FDP given after occlusion of the LAD in this canine model did not limit early myocardial infarct size.

摘要

研究目的

在先前的犬类研究中,1,6-二磷酸果糖(FDP)似乎可改善心肌梗死后早期的血流动力学,并限制早期心肌梗死面积。然而,这些研究并未考虑侧支血流对梗死面积的影响。我们的目的是在测量局部心肌血流的同时,确定FDP对早期梗死面积和血流动力学的影响。

设计

一项前瞻性、双盲、安慰剂对照的实验室研究,采用犬类开胸左前降支冠状动脉(LAD)闭塞模型。

干预措施

22只杂种犬在LAD闭塞后5分钟开始随机接受FDP(175mg/kg,然后以2mg/kg/min持续输注2小时)或安慰剂。

测量指标及主要结果

测定局部心肌血流、血流动力学和心肌梗死面积。在一部分动物中使用磁共振成像评估梗死面积。22只犬中有3只无梗死,其侧支血流明显高于19只有心肌梗死的动物(P<.001)。LAD闭塞4小时后,两组间的心指数、dP/dtmax、心率以及收缩压和平均主动脉压无统计学差异。以坏死面积/危险面积表示的梗死面积在两组间相似(FDP组为0.55±0.28;对照组为0.59±0.31)。

结论

在此犬类模型中,LAD闭塞后给予FDP并不能限制早期心肌梗死面积。
